The Complete Guide to Web Design Process

A good website rarely happens by accident. It’s the output of a web design process, a sequence of stages that takes a project from a vague goal to a launched, working site without the expensive backtracking that plagues ad-hoc builds. This guide walks through that process end to end: discovery, strategy, information architecture, wireframing, visual design, build, testing, and launch, plus what happens after. Whether you’re hiring an agency, managing an internal project, or learning the craft, understanding each stage helps you spot when a project is skipping steps it will pay for later. A clear process is what separates sites that work from ones that merely look finished.

What the web design process is and why it matters

The web design process is the structured path a project follows from an initial idea to a live, maintained website. Its whole purpose is to reduce risk and rework by making decisions in the right order, research before strategy, structure before visuals, design before code, testing before launch. When teams skip that order, the cost doesn’t disappear, it shows up later as a redesign, a missed deadline, or a site that looks polished but fails the business behind it.

A defined process also gives everyone a shared map. The client knows what to expect and when their input is needed, the designers know what’s been decided and signed off, and nobody is guessing. Most projects that go over budget or over time do so because they had no clear web design process and made decisions out of order, then had to unwind them. Structure is what keeps a build predictable.

Discovery: research before design

Discovery is the research phase, and it’s the one most often cut to save time, which is exactly why so many projects go wrong. Before anyone sketches a layout, the team needs to understand the business goals, the target audience, the competitors, and what success looks like in measurable terms. This is where you gather requirements, audit any existing site, interview stakeholders, and learn how the audience thinks and searches. The output is a clear brief everyone agrees on.

Good discovery prevents the most expensive kind of mistake, building the wrong thing well. A beautiful site aimed at the wrong audience or missing the features the business needs is a failure no amount of visual polish fixes. Spending real time here, days to weeks depending on the project, is what makes every later stage faster, because the team is executing against clear decisions rather than guessing and revising.

Strategy and information architecture

With discovery done, strategy turns findings into a plan and information architecture turns the plan into a structure. Strategy decides what the site must do, which pages it needs, what actions matter most, and how success will be measured. Information architecture then organizes all the content into a logical sitemap and navigation, deciding what lives where and how users move between pages. This is the skeleton every later stage hangs on.

Getting architecture right prevents the confused navigation that sinks otherwise good sites. Techniques like card sorting, where you test how real users group and label content, ground the structure in how people think rather than how the org chart is arranged. A sitemap and a set of user flows come out of this stage, and both should be reviewed and signed off before wireframing starts, because reworking structure after visual design is slow and expensive.

Wireframing: structure before style

Wireframing is where structure gets drawn without the distraction of color, imagery, or brand. A wireframe is a low-fidelity layout, boxes and labels showing what goes where on each key page, the hierarchy of elements, and how the page guides the eye toward its main action. Working in grayscale on purpose keeps everyone focused on function and flow instead of debating a shade of blue while the layout is still unsettled.

This stage is fast and cheap to change, which is the point, moving a block in a wireframe takes seconds, moving it after the page is designed and built takes hours. Wireframe the important templates, the homepage, a key landing page, a product or article page, and use them to agree on layout and content priority. Once the wireframes are approved, visual design has a solid frame to work within and far fewer surprises appear late.

Visual design and prototyping

Visual design is the stage most people picture when they think of web design, layering brand, color, typography, imagery, and detail onto the approved wireframes. Because the structure is already settled, designers can focus on look and feel, hierarchy, and the emotional tone the brand wants, rather than solving layout and aesthetics at the same time. The output is a high-fidelity design of each key template, often assembled into an interactive prototype.

A clickable prototype is worth building because it lets everyone experience the site before a line of code is written. Stakeholders click through real flows, catch issues while they’re cheap to fix, and sign off on something close to the finished feel. Design decisions should also be captured as reusable components and tokens here, so the build stays consistent and the site can grow later without every new page reinventing the wheel.

Development and content

Development turns the approved design into a working site. Front-end developers build the interfaces from the design, matching spacing, type, and behavior, while back-end work handles any content management, forms, databases, or ecommerce. This is also where real content replaces the placeholder text, and where responsive behavior gets built so the site works across phones, tablets, and desktops rather than only at the size it was designed.

Content deserves its own mention because it’s the piece most often left to the last minute. A build waiting on copy and images stalls, and rushed content undermines a good design. The strongest projects prepare real content in parallel with design so it’s ready when the build needs it. Close collaboration between designers and developers during this stage catches the small mismatches, spacing, states, edge cases, that separate a faithful build from an approximate one.

Testing, launch, and the web design process after go-live

Testing is a real phase in the web design process, not a quick glance before launch. Check the site across browsers and devices, test every form and interactive element, run performance and page-speed checks, and audit accessibility against WCAG so the site works for everyone. Proofread the content, verify links, and confirm analytics and tracking are in place. Each issue found here is cheap to fix, while the same issue found after launch costs far more and may cost sales.

Launch itself should be planned, not improvised, with a checklist covering redirects from old URLs, search-engine indexing, backups, and monitoring. The web design process doesn’t end at go-live, that’s where the maintenance phase begins. A site needs updates, security patches, content changes, and improvements based on real user data. Treating launch as the finish line is how sites slowly decay, while treating it as a milestone keeps them working and improving over time.

How the web design process changes by project

No two projects run the web design process identically, and knowing where to flex it is part of the skill. A small brochure site might compress discovery and design into a couple of weeks and skip a formal prototype, while a large ecommerce build needs deep discovery, extensive architecture, and thorough testing across many templates. The stages stay the same, their depth scales to the project’s size, risk, and budget. What never pays off is skipping a stage entirely to move faster.

The order also isn’t always strictly linear, real projects loop back as testing reveals something or a client shifts direction, but the sequence still guides the work. Frequently asked questions

What are the stages of the web design process?
The web design process typically runs through discovery, strategy, information architecture, wireframing, visual design, development, testing, and launch, followed by ongoing maintenance. Each stage ends in a sign-off before the next begins. The order matters, because deciding structure before visuals and design before code prevents expensive rework.
How long does the web design process take?
It depends on scope. A small brochure site can be finished in a few weeks, while a large ecommerce or custom build runs several months. The biggest variable is the size and complexity of the content and features, followed by how quickly the client provides feedback and content.
Why is discovery important in the web design process?
Discovery is where the team learns the business goals, audience, and requirements before any design happens. Skipping it is the most expensive shortcut in the web design process, because building the wrong thing well is a failure no amount of visual polish can fix. Good discovery makes every later stage faster.
What's the difference between wireframes and visual design?
Wireframes are low-fidelity layouts that settle what goes where without color or brand, while visual design layers the look and feel onto that approved structure. Separating them lets the team agree on layout before debating aesthetics, which prevents the costly rework of changing structure after a page is fully designed.
Does the web design process end at launch?
No. Launch is a milestone, not the finish line, in the web design process. A live site needs maintenance, security updates, content changes, and improvements based on real user data. Treating launch as the end is how sites slowly decay, while ongoing care keeps them effective.
